| Criteria | Edge | Why |
|---|---|---|
| Crispiness | Miss Vickie's | Miss Vickie's chips are renowned for their thicker, more robust crunch, outperforming Doritos on the crispiness scale. |
| Flavor | Doritos | Doritos offers a bolder, more diverse range of flavors that explode with each bite, making them the clear winner in flavor. |
| Appearance | Doritos | Doritos' vibrant color and dusting of flavoring give them an edge in visual appeal over the more subdued Miss Vickie's. |
| Nutrition | Miss Vickie's | Miss Vickie's uses fewer processed ingredients and generally has a better nutritional profile compared to Doritos. |
